Construction of Ore Slurry Pipeline of Bayan Obo

Article Preview

Abstract:

As the largest ore slurry pipeline system,and the third iron concentrate slurry pipeline interiorly, include the longest water pipeline with only one pump station in China, Bayan Obo slurry pipeline engineering of Baotou has been operated. It can transports 5.5 million tonnes of iron ore concentrate and 2000 million m3/h of water per year. In order to overcome freezing temperature and rugged terrain,many technical problems has been resolved in the period of construction.
